Transaction 299cc53439907f5b8efad4e19ea5f3607e1ba33dbf8d91b816086e5094c74449

block
f805857160d07a856a7a31940d9bdb83ed5ca32d685d5399b9a52e9f047e70c9

2 Inputs

2 Outputs